Transaction 515a55adc156cd145f8e8d0fc08b1fc9e41310d256822db35e497a95b58a747a
1 Input
2 Outputs
- 515a55adc156cd145f8e8d0fc08b1fc9e41310d256822db35e497a95b58a747a:0
- 515a55adc156cd145f8e8d0fc08b1fc9e41310d256822db35e497a95b58a747a:1
value 718000
address 1CpFQEvEf4DVBRQnEaGdSgsNCBqr4aDG93
value 348445697
address 3DMytwmpjqVDaRiVxh749mhw7U1x3daJbB